Dreamland was singer Robert Plant's 7th solo album and the first with the band "Strange Sensation". The album was released in July 2002.
Many of the songs are cover versions, mainly blues, but also some rock. It was nominated for two Grammys in 2002 — The Best Rock Album and The Best Male Rock Performance.
[edit] Track listing
- "Funny in My Mind (I Believe I'm Fixin' to Die)" (Justin Adams, John Baggot, Clive Dreamer, Charlie Jones, Robert Plant, Porl Thompson, Bukka White) – 4:45
- "Morning Dew" (Bonnie Dobson, Tim Rose) – 4:26
- "One More Cup of Coffee" (Bob Dylan) – 4:03
- "Last Time I Saw Her" (Adams, Baggot, Dreamer, Jones, Plant, Thompson) – 4:41
- "Song to the Siren" (Larry Beckett, Tim Buckley) – 5:53
- "Win My Train Fare Home (If I Ever Get Lucky)" (Adams, Baggot, Dreamer, Jones, Plant, Thompson) – 6:03
- "Darkness, Darkness" (Jesse Colin Young) – 7:25
- "Red Dress" (Adams, Baggot, Dreamer, Jones, Plant, Thompson) – 5:23
- "Hey Joe" (Billy Roberts) – 7:12
- "Skip's Song" (Skip Spence) – 4:27
- "Dirt In A Hole" (Bonus Track, UK & Japanese Version) – 4:46
